Bouncy, bubbly babies will soon be putting their best little foot forward as shoe brand Skeanie releases its limited edition Love Me shoes. Pink and silver, without robbing you of your gold, the adorable little slippers will retail for $29.95, with $1.50 from each pair being donated towards the McGrath Foundation.
The fashionable shoes are podiatry-approved with 100% leather, so tiny tootsies can breathe and grow naturally, while the suede soul provides grip for crawlers and walkers alike (I wonder if they make my size?).
These adorable pint-sized wardrobe additions are also helping to support the legacy left by the late Jane McGrath. Her inspirational vision was to support McGrath Breast Care Nurses around Australia and educate young women on breast awareness.
So now anywhere you go, whenever you see a set of tiny pink feet you know that not only is bub comfy, but she is helping her mum, other mums and women everywhere.
